House fire in Lake Zurich, 5-15-17

On Monday, May 15, 2017, at approximately 10:58 p.m., the Lake Zurich Fire Department responded to a house fire at 22580 Somerset Court. Upon arrival, firefighters discovered that the garage and several vehicles were already engulfed in flames. Due to the severity of the situation and the lack of nearby hydrants, the alarm was upgraded to a MABAS Box Alarm, which brought in multiple fire engines and water tenders to transport water to the scene. This coordinated effort ensured that crews had the necessary resources to control the blaze effectively. The fire caused significant damage to the property, with the garage and surrounding structures heavily affected. Firefighters worked diligently to prevent the fire from spreading further and to protect nearby homes. Several neighboring departments, including Long Grove and Fox Lake, also sent additional units to assist in the response.
